An Oral Surgeon, also known as an oral and maxillofacial surgeon, provides complex treatments to conditions affecting the mouth, teeth, jaw, and face. Their roles within the dental industry include performing surgical procedures such as removing impacted teeth, placing dental implants, reconstructing facial trauma, and treating oral cancers. They play a critical role in the industry by providing treatments that are beyond the scope of general dentists and require specialized surgical expertise.

To become an Oral Surgeon, one must possess certain qualifications and skills. An Oral Surgeon should have a Doctor of Dental Surgery (DDS) or Doctor of Medicine in Dentistry (DMD) degree from an accredited dental school, and complete a hospital-based oral and maxillofacial surgery residency program, which typically lasts 4-6 years. They must also obtain a state license to practice dentistry and in some cases, they may need to be board certified. Crucial skills for an Oral Surgeon include manual dexterity, physical stamina, and excellent interpersonal skills as they often work with patients who may be anxious about surgery. Prior to becoming an Oral Surgeon, a professional may work as a General Dentist, Dental Hygienist, or Maxillofacial Surgery Resident.
